Delicious Old-Fashioned Shortcake Recipe

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 8 people
Calories 430 kcal

Ingredients
  

BUTTER BISCUIT DOUGH

  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cake flour
  • 2 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up cold unsalted butter
  • 3/4 cup Buttermilk or heavy cream

TOPPING AND FILLING

  • 1- quart strawberries or other fruit
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1/3 cup sugar
  • 1 1/2 cup heavy cream

BEFORE BAKING:

  • 2 tablespoon buttermilk
  • 2 tablespoons butter room temperature
  • 2 tablespoons sugar

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 450F; set the rack on the middle level.
  • BUTTERMILK BISCUIT DOUGH: Combine all the flours, salt, and baking powder in a mixing bowl and stir well to mix.
  • Rub in the butter by hand or with a pastry blender until the mixture is mealy. Stir in 3/4 cup of the buttermilk with a fork and continue stirring gently until the dough begins to hold together. (If the dough is dry, add more buttermilk, 1 tablespoon at a time.)
  • Sprinkle the work surface generously with flour and scrape the dough onto it. Fold the dough over itself two or three times.
  • Use the dough immediately for shortcakes, following the instructions above. Use this recipe to make a large shortcake or eight small ones.
  • Prepare biscuits: For a large shortcake, pat the dough into a 9-inch disk on a parchment-lined cookie sheet.
  • For individual shortcakes, pat dough into a 6-by-12- inch rectangle and cut into eight 3-inch biscuits with a sharp, floured knife.
  • Transfer to a parchment-lined cookie sheet. Brush tops with buttermilk. Sprinkle with sugar.
  • Bake for 10 to 15 minutes, until well risen and golden.
  • Check the center of the large shortcake with a toothpick to make sure it is baked through: If the pick emerges with the dough still clinging to it, lower temperature to 350F and bake another 5 minutes.
  • Slide the large shortcake onto a platter immediately after it is baked. Use a sharp, serrated knife to slice through the middle, making two layers.
  • Slide the edge of a cookie sheet between the two layers and lift the top layer off. Butter the bottom layer and pour all but 1/2 cup of the sweetened fruit on. Slide the top back on and pour the remaining berries over the top.
  • Split the small shortcakes in the same way and place the bottoms on individual dessert plates.
  • Butter them and top with about 1/3 cup of the fruit mixture. Replace tops and pour a tablespoon or so of the remaining berries over the top.
  • Serve immediately. Pass the cream in a bowl for the guests to help themselves.
